Formiz website GitHub. Go to the directory ‘src’ and execute command prompt there and run command. First parameter is a number of actual step, second parameter is jquery wrap for wizard. Company. reditus. Name of function or anonym function. Current Step: 1. The question is published on July 8, 2020 by Tutorial Guruji team. The form was developed by Tommy Marshall and the demo has about form fieldsets that users can fill with each step named. After the React app has installed, run. React wizard (stepper) builder without the hassle, powered by hooks.. Latest version: 2.2.0, last published: an hour ago. this.props.jumpToStep(2) will jump to your 3rd step (it uses a zero based index) check out src/examples/Step2 for an actual usage example We have imported different ui-classes in this component like Stepper, StepLabel etc. When we create a react app in we will have App.js and index.js in the file Communicate to user their status in a series of steps...what's active/done/available. First parameter is a number of actual step, second is the number of coming step. Read the official Bootstrap Stepper Documentation for a full list of instructions and other options. The command above will create a simple folder structure for your application, then install all the necessary modules and get your project up and running for you. Step 5: In this file, we will implement Stepper Form to submit Personal Details, Education Details, and Address of a user.Stepper is created using material-ui in react. Next, we'll create an object to hold the values our user will be entering. React Bootstrap 5 Stepper is a component that shows content in the form of a process with user-defined milestones. your individual react steps can implement some checks to prevent moving onto the next step, this is called "validation" in stepzilla. to use this feature, you need to implement a public isValidated () method in your react step component. Go Back Finish. Multi-Step/Wizard form without routing and useFormContext, conditional values not persisted June 17, 2020 at 10:10am (Edited 2 years ago ) Hi there, I can't figure out how to use the useFormContext to persist the values of conditionally displayed input fields. As such, we scored react-step-wizard popularity level to be Recognized. The awesome jQuery step wizard plugin. Start using react-use-wizard in your project by running `npm i react-use-wizard`. React .Js multi-step form comes with a progress bar that indicates well; progress. A simple API to build from simple loading bars to complex progress bars with steps. Other Functions. For Progress bar, we’ll import ProgressBar class from ‘react-bootstrap’. Here we are in codesandbox.io with a react app sandbox. step by step explain how to use the FlatList component using react-native. Download limit exceeded. Installation: # NPM $ npm install react-step-wizard --save Preview: Download Details: Author: jcmcneal. active-step: Current active step. Adding Bootstrap Progress Bar in ReactJs App. The transitions are executed SMOOTHLY, almost gently. winston. When we create a react app in we will have App.js and index.js in the file The Drawer implementation translates the position into classnames, and uses CSS transitions for the animation. At the beginning is a welcome-step and at the end the user sees a thank-you website. This stepper displays a transient feedback message after a step is saved. function (from, data) {} onSlideChanged. YAML 1.2 parser and serializer. In your terminal, run the following: npx create-react-app multistep-form; This will create a sample React application with the development environment fully configured. Name * Email * Fill with john@company.com. Example; className: String '' Add custom classes to MDBStepper element linear: Boolean: false: Set to true to use the linear stepper formWizard: Boolean: false: Set to true to use the form wizard stepper noEditable: Boolean: false: Set to true to block editing of the completed step So, let's following example: Step 1 - Create project Steps is a navigation bar that guides users through the steps of a task.. I am using a new React app while writing this article for the accuracy of information. Tagged Progress, Visualization. Here you'll learn to easily create your own progress bars and customize them. Breaking up large forms into multiple steps makes them less daunting for the user to complete. Do you love it? clodoveo. And you can easily customize this jQuery multi step form wizard for jquery and css library. Create react application; Add bootstrap in application; Design a page to create a step wizard; Handle Back/Next buttons click event; Output; 1. Try It Out! Each page on a wizard is a different state. Add Routing. A library to create stunning progress bars and steps in React. Get Started. Other Example Implementations. . All these questions should be one step in the wizard. In your project create a new file or start a new component from an existing file. Out of the box, it might come ideal for an online shoe store, but you can quickly alter it and utilize it for something entirely different.. A fantastic registration form takes the user through a three-step process to complete the registration. 1. Also create components, router, and utils folders inside the src folder. #Variants. Most used react-step-wizard functions. qs. At the last step, the creator has included an option for users to upload files too if necessary. Step 1. Installation: npm install react-multistep Simple Multi Step Form Wizard with Validation in VueJS. Building a step wizard with react native In the past few months with this pandemic situation, I decided it’s time to take the dust off after leaving react native for a while and get back to building things again, !yes, I’d given myself a break meanwhile I was keeping doing interesting things with angular. A library to create stunning progress bars and steps in React. So you can do it Here I will give you full example for jquery multi step form wizard plugin with validation. react-step-wizard. And then react-hooks-helper dependency added to the sandbox. Here is a free and fully responsive Bootstrap Wizard template featuring a neat and simple design. To install TypeScript with create-react-app, run the following one-liner in your terminal: npx create-react-app . Need to implement the react-stepper-horizontal that will have the form as wrapper and each components as steps. React Albus. Higher-order functions and common patterns for asynchronous code. The gist is in the DrawerContainer … Show activity on this post. Next, we'll create an object to hold the values our user will be entering. So you and me are in this journey together! Which is the best react wizard / steps plugin Does any one have idea about the best open source react wizard / steps plugin available with step validation and vertical steps as I couldn't find one. When To Use #. Setting up a Wizard. Form is implemented using proactive step and ActiveStep. The npm package react-simple-step-wizard receives a total of 142 downloads a week. Bootstrap Stepper is a smart UI component which allows you to easily create wizard-like interfaces. This is an excellent option for a variety of registration forms in which you don't want … Star it! It's name and index are exposed on the deployed payload. stepzilla injects an utility method called jumpToStep as a prop into all your react step components; this utility methods lets you jump between steps from inside your react component e.g. A simple progress bar. Since 0.6.4, button slots can be also used as scoped slots and have the following methods/properties exposed. For this tutorial, we’ll use the npm init method. You can customize an expression to set the status of the Wizard Item or you can use the predefined values Active, Next, and Past. Edit. Workflows/wizards are useful when you want the end-user to complete a series of steps. First, you will use npx to use create-react-app to generate your project. Multi-step Form Interface is another unique and innovative Bootstrap Wizard example that has multiple sections. Now you can mark your step object as completed if you desire it. js-yaml. I am building a wizard based on React, Redux and React Router V4. A React multi-step form component used to create a responsive step-by-step wizard form for your web application. react-step-wizard StepWizard. Wizard Form. To go to the next or previous step, you can use the useState hook like in the example below. I would like to show you the FlastList example in react native. React Native Wizard Stepper. Create react application There are 23 other projects in the npm registry using react-step-wizard. At first I was thinking maybe I could just use a plugin for this? There is 1 other project in the npm registry using react-use-wizard. Once you've created the project, delete all files from the src folder and create an index.js file and a styles.scss file inside the src folder. Bootstrap 5 Stepper is a component that shows content in the form of a process with user milestones. The delay prop is the time before the slider appears, and the two others are related to its position. Add Animation. Nested Fields. Building a Wizard / Workflow in React. Step 3: Install the necessary dependencies. react-multistep: Multi-step form component (wizard). And then react-hooks-helper dependency added to the sandbox. $ npx create-react-app rsb-demo $ npm install react-step-builder. completed-step: Triggered when a step is completed. Have your step components ready. The Drawer implementation translates the position into classnames, and uses CSS transitions for the animation. Add Progress Bar. Button Container Divider Flag Header Icon Image Input Label List Loader Placeholder Rail Reveal Segment Step. While I was working on a e-commerce site for a client, there was a part that I had to work on a Wizard / Stepper form for the checkout page. this.props.jumpToStep(2) will jump to your 3rd step (it uses a zero based index) check out src/examples/Step2 for an actual usage example For example, the level of validation put into code isn't there towards the end. Wizard Form Example. We’ll name this Wizard.razor, so we will be able to use the component with a tag like . cd multi-step-form-tutorial. Getting Started. react-expandable-nav: Expandable left-side nav. Welcome to react-step-progress-bar! Buttons divide and connect the stages that follow. i18n - Internationalization and localization. Here we are in codesandbox.io with a react app sandbox. Step 1 — Initializing a new React Project with Semantic UI. One common UI design pattern is to separate a single form out into sepearate pages of inputs, commonly known as a Wizard. This plugin groups content into sections for a more structured and orderly page view. When a given task is complicated or has a certain sequence in the series of subtasks, we can decompose it into several steps to make things easier. A Wizard Form in React. Github. Can collapse to icons, expand to full text. Here we will create a multi-step wizard that you can use to collect information through steps like signup form, order tracking form, etc. to access the folder first.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Usage example and implementation details are presented in 0.6.2 release. The main page is server rendered, but then the form steps are regular react client side rendered, I'm able to use react context, or a simple state machine to store the form data and progress. The delay prop is the time before the slider appears, and the two others are related to its position. Examples; GitHub; react-step-progress-barA library to create stunning progress bars and steps in React. Gotium. Step 1. Provides a neat and stylish interface for your forms, checkout screen, registration steps, etc. Example. ; Specify the destroyOnUnmount: false flag … Covering popular subjects like HTML, CSS, JavaScript, Python, … stepzilla injects an utility method called jumpToStep as a prop into all your react step components; this utility methods lets you jump between steps from inside your react component e.g. React .Js multi-step Form with a Progress Bar. First Step Last Step Go to Step 2. Completed meaning that current step has been left behind on the step list. Demonstrates how to use React Final Form to create a multi-page "wizard" form, with validation on each page. Form Wizard. Submit v7.0.0. react-step-wizzard-effects. Set the status of the Wizard Item relative to the current step of the Wizard. Create a new project using create-react-app: npx create-react-app multi-step-form-using-mern. resolritter. Latest version: 5.3.11, last published: 4 months ago. Wizard Form. async. Easy implementation, Bootstrap compatiblity, customizable toolbars, themes, events and Ajax support are few of the features. react-detector: Chrome extension that detects ReactJS apps as you browse. rc-nutrition-calculator. Could you please kindly help me in making horizontal the step wizard form that has the components as each steps? Thanks in advance..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Code is on github. Use this template for whatever you want as long as you include the original copyright and license notice in any copy of the software/source. GitHub CHANGELOG. Customizable. There are Vue packages available for this but I wanted to do implement it myself with the simplest implementation. import React from 'react'; import useStepper from '@xolos/react-stepper'; const stepIds = ['foo', 'bar', 'buzz']; function App() { const { currentStepId, goToNextStep, goToPreviousStep, } = useStepper(stepIds); return (